iTunes 4.9 to Support Podcasting

Yep, it's official today. Jobs announced this wonderful piece of news at D: All Things Digital, an annual technology conference sponsored by The Wall Street Journal.

You'll be able to browse and download Podcasts and, I assume, purchase them online just like you did music.  This will vastly simplify the process of getting people excited about listening to Podcasts. Now you will not have to explain RSS feeds, or use yet another software package like iPodder that runs separately on your machine to transfer Podcasts to your PC for insertion into your iPod or MP3 player. This will all be integrated into iTunes 4.9 and will be transparent to the user - as it should be.

I can imagine we'll soon see this same capability integrated into other services that sell online music.
